Lack of materials, contractors still strive to build bridges to keep up with the progress of the expressway

Can Tho - The entire Chau Doc - Can Tho - Soc Trang expressway has constructed 96/100 bridges, many bridges are about to be completed and open to traffic in August.

Component project 4 of the Chau Doc - Can Tho - Soc Trang Expressway project passing through the old Soc Trang province (Component project 4) has a total length of more than 58 km, including 46 bridges over the river, fields and routes. To date, contractors have implemented the construction of 44/46 bridges.

Recorded at overpass No. 27, under package No. 11, Component Project 4, workers are urgently deploying the remaining items such as completing, paving concrete 2 bridge slopes, railings to complete and open to traffic in time in August.

Mr. Tran Anh Tuan - Truong Son Construction Corporation, Commander of Package No. 11 - said that up to now, all 12 bridges under the package have been deployed simultaneously. In particular, strive to open overpasses 27 and 34 in August 2025. The remaining 10 bridges have completed the bridge deck and railings.

Mr. Phung Ngoc Manh - representative of Brigade 99, Corps 12, Truong Son Construction Corporation - informed that the unit is taking charge of the construction of 3 bridges on the route. Currently, 2 out of 3 bridges under the management of the unit have completed the bridge deck, the railing section has reached about 90%. The construction of the remaining bridge is being accelerated with the construction of the lower structure, girders, and piers. The overall progress of bridge items is currently basically meeting the requirements.

Mr. Manh said that to ensure progress, all forces were arranged to work in 3 shifts, 4 teams, not afraid of the sun and rain. The construction site has been fully arranged with temporary accommodation and accommodation for about 150 workers, to ensure health and maintain construction manpower, with the goal of completing the project on schedule, serving the travel needs and socio-economic development of local people.

At bridge No. 22, package No. 10 of Component Project 4, more than 50 engineers and workers are also constructing the surface and railing. This bridge crosses National Highway 1A, the section passing through My Xuyen Ward, Can Tho City. Mr. Hoang Ngoc Giang, technical officer of the site of Dat Phuong Group Joint Stock Company, said that bridge No. 22 is expected to be completed in August. Bridge No. 29 belongs to the same package that was completed earlier.

According to the Management Board of the Can Tho City Traffic and Agricultural Construction Investment Project, the Chau Doc - Can Tho - Soc Trang Expressway Construction Investment Project Phase 1, the section through Can Tho City (after the merger) includes component projects 2, 3 and 4, with a total length of 132.47 km, a total investment of nearly 31,300 billion VND.

All 3 component projects have a total of 11 construction packages. As of the end of July 2025, the overall construction progress has reached nearly 42% of the volume value. Of which, Component Project 2 reached nearly 40.5%, Component 3 reached 45.83% and Component 4 about 40%. Currently, the progress of bridge projects on the route has reached and exceeded the set plan, 96/100 bridges have been constructed on the route, the remaining bridges will be deployed in 2025.

According to the Management Board, the total demand for sand for all three component projects of about 21.1 million m3 has so far been determined to be more than 14 million m3, of which about 5.6 million m3 have been exploited and transported to the project. The nearly 7 million m3 still lacking is continuing to contact localities such as An Giang, Dong Thap, Vinh Long to carry out exploitation procedures and supplement sand sources for the project.

The investor is also directing consulting units and construction contractors to coordinate in surveying, studying and adjusting the design and construction measures appropriately, in order to shorten the progress and ensure the completion of the project in accordance with the requirements of the Prime Minister.
